WebA firewall is a fire-resistant barrier used to prevent the spread of fire. Firewalls are built between or through buildings, structures, or electrical substation transformers, or within an aircraft or vehicle. ... Fire barrier walls are typically constructed of drywall or gypsum board partitions with wood or metal framed studs. WebIn general, thicker drywall tends to be associated with higher fire resistance. However, the notion that the thicker a dry wall is the greater its fire resistance is not entirely correct. Type C is another drywall that is typically ⅝” thick, however it is known for having even greater fire resistance than type X drywall.

WebA: Both drywall Type X and Type C are approved for use in a 60-minute rated design. The wall systems they are approved for are different, however.
